Vlad Dragulin, a Romanian TV personality, was born on September 5, 1990, in Romania. He showed an interest in the performing arts from a young age and pursued his dreams by studying at the prestigious Caragiale Academy of Theatrical Arts and Cinematography.
In 2010, Vlad Dragulin made his screen debut on the show În Puii Mei! This marked the beginning of his journey in the entertainment industry, where he quickly gained recognition for his talent and charisma.
Vlad Dragulin's breakthrough role came when he portrayed Malone on the popular Romanian TV show Baieti de Oras from 2016 to 2018. His captivating performance resonated with audiences, solidifying his status as a rising star in the Romanian entertainment scene.
In 2018, Vlad Dragulin expanded his career horizons by becoming the co-host of Serbia's X-Factor. This opportunity allowed him to showcase his versatile skills and establish himself as a dynamic presence on an international platform.
